Introduction
The trade-off between more detailed hourly forecasts and faster load times for AccuWeather's mobile app presents a critical decision point for the product team. This scenario touches on the core value proposition of a weather app: providing accurate, timely information while ensuring a smooth user experience. I'll analyze this trade-off by examining user needs, technical considerations, and business implications to arrive at a strategic recommendation.
